Shares of Clearway Energy Inc (NYSE: CWEN) tumbled 5.03% in intraday trading on Wednesday after the company announced a $100 million At-The-Market (ATM) equity offering program. The significant drop reflects investors' concerns about potential share dilution and its impact on stock value.

The ATM program, revealed early Wednesday, allows Clearway Energy to sell up to $100 million worth of its Class C common stock through several major financial institutions acting as sales agents. These include Morgan Stanley, BofA Securities, Citigroup, J.P. Morgan, and Wells Fargo Securities. The company plans to issue shares at market prices, which could potentially dilute the ownership stake of existing shareholders, explaining the negative market reaction.

Clearway Energy, one of the largest clean energy generation asset owners in the U.S., stated that it intends to use the net proceeds from the share sales for general corporate purposes. This may include debt repayment, refinancing, funding working capital, capital expenditures, and potential acquisitions and investments. While the ATM program provides financial flexibility for the company, the market's immediate response suggests that investors are wary of the potential dilutive effects on their holdings.
